如何在WordPress中启用浏览器缓存
浏览器缓存是一种技术,它允许浏览器在用户首次访问网站时下载并存储页面资源,如图像、样式表、脚本和其他文件。随后,当用户再次访问相同的页面或导航到其他页面时,浏览器可以使用已缓存的文件,而不必重新下载它们。这加速了页面加载时间,减少了对服务器的负载,提高了用户体验。
启用浏览器缓存后,用户可以更快地加载您的网页,因为他们的浏览器只需下载已经缓存的文件,而不是每次都重新下载它们。这尤其有助于减少加载时间较长的页面,提供流畅的浏览体验。
为什么启用浏览器缓存对 WordPress 网站至关重要?
启用浏览器缓存对于 WordPress 网站非常重要,有以下几个原因:
- 提高加载速度:启用浏览器缓存可以大幅提高网站加载速度,使用户更快地访问页面。这对于提高用户体验和吸引访问者至关重要。
- 减少服务器负载:当浏览器可以使用缓存的资源时,服务器的负载会减少,因为不再需要频繁地提供相同的文件。这有助于减轻服务器的工作负担。
- 降低带宽成本:如果您的网站使用云托管或按流量计费的托管,启用浏览器缓存可以降低带宽成本,因为用户不必每次都重新下载相同的资源。
- 提高搜索引擎排名:搜索引擎,如 Google,将网站速度作为搜索排名的一个因素。通过提高加载速度,您的网站有更高的机会在搜索引擎结果中排名较高。
如何在 WordPress 中启用浏览器缓存
现在,让我们详细讨论如何在 WordPress 中启用浏览器缓存。这个过程相对简单,需要遵循以下步骤:
第 1 步:备份您的网站
在进行任何更改之前,始终备份您的 WordPress 网站。这是非常重要的,因为如果在配置浏览器缓存时出现问题,您可以还原到以前的状态。您可以使用 WordPress 插件或主机提供的工具来进行备份。
第 2 步:选择合适的插件
要在 WordPress 中启用浏览器缓存,您可以使用缓存插件。有许多可供选择的插件,其中一些最受欢迎的包括:
- W3 Total Cache:这是一个功能强大的插件,提供了多种缓存选项,包括浏览器缓存。它可以显著提高网站性能。
- WP Super Cache:这是一个易于使用的插件,它专注于页面缓存和浏览器缓存,是一个不错的选择。
- WP Fastest Cache:这个插件也非常受欢迎,它提供了浏览器缓存功能,同时具有一些其他优化功能。
在本文中,我们将使用 W3 Total Cache 作为示例插件,但其他插件的操作原理类似。
第 3 步:安装和激活插件
首先,登录到您的 WordPress 仪表板,然后转到“插件” > “添加新插件”。在搜索框中输入“W3 Total Cache”,找到插件并单击“安装现在”。安装完成后,点击“激活”以启用插件。
第 4 步:配置插件
一旦插件被激活,您将在仪表板的左侧菜单中看到“性能”选项。点击“性能”以访问插件的设置。
在“性能”设置中,您将看到多个选项卡,包括“一般设置”、“页面缓存”、“浏览器缓存”等。我们将关注“浏览器缓存”选项卡。
第 5 步:配置浏览器缓存
在“浏览器缓存”选项卡中,您可以启用浏览器缓存功能。通常,您只需勾选相应的选项即可,然后点击“保存设置”。
下面是一些常见的设置选项:
- 启用浏览器缓存:确保这个选项已经勾选。
- HTTP 压缩:启用这个选项可以减小文件大小,提高加载速度。
- 过期时间:您可以设置资源的过期时间。通常,这是以秒为单位的时间段,例如,一个月是 2592000 秒。
- 强制浏览器重新获取:如果您更新网站资源频繁,可以启用此选项,以确保浏览器始终获取最新版本。
第 6 步:测试您的网站
一旦您配置了浏览器缓存选项,建议测试您的网站,以确保一切正常。您可以使用浏览器的开发者工具(通常按 F12 键打开)来检查 HTTP 标头,查看资源是否正确缓存。
高级设置和调整
如果您希望更深入地优化浏览器缓存,可以考虑以下高级设置和调整:
- CDN 集成:如果您使用内容分发网络(CDN),确保您的插件与 CDN 一起正常工作,以提供更快的全球加载速度。
- GZIP 压缩:启用 GZIP 压缩可以进一步减小文件大小,加快加载速度。
- 文件版本控制:通过为文件添加版本号,您可以确保浏览器总是获取最新版本的资源。
- 清除缓存:定期清除缓存,以确保更新的内容能够迅速反映在您的网站上。
- 监控和分析:使用工具如 Google PageSpeed Insights 或 GTmetrix 来监控您的网站性能,并根据建议进行进一步的调整。
常见问题和故障排除
在启用浏览器缓存时,可能会遇到一些常见问题。以下是一些可能的问题和解决方法:
- 资源没有更新:如果您在网站上进行了更改但浏览器仍然加载旧的资源,尝试清除浏览器缓存或强制刷新页面(通常按 Ctrl + F5 或 Cmd + Shift + R)。
- 错误页面显示:如果您的网站出现错误或不正常的行为,请检查插件配置是否正确。也可以尝试禁用插件并查看是否问题解决。
- 兼容性问题:不同的浏览器可能在处理缓存时表现不同,因此请在不同的浏览器中测试您的网站,以确保一切正常。
- 服务器问题:如果您在配置浏览器缓存时遇到问题,也可能是与您的服务器相关的问题。与您的托管提供商联系以获得支持。
总结
启用浏览器缓存是提高 WordPress 网站性能的关键步骤。通过减少资源加载时间,减轻服务器负担,降低带宽成本,提高搜索引擎排名,您可以提供更好的用户体验,并吸引更多的访问者。使用适当的插件和设置,您可以轻松地配置浏览器缓存,并在不降低网站质量的前提下提高性能。不仅将您的网站变得更快,还将提高您的在线存在感和声誉。